### Release Checklist — Item 7: Watchdog Verification (Orchard Kiosk)

Since you're new to the Orchard kiosk project: every kiosk runs a watchdog daemon called Sentinel that restarts the UI shell if it stops heartbeating. Before sign-off, boot a test unit, kill the shell process manually, and confirm Sentinel recovers it within 20 seconds and logs the restart reason. Also confirm the watchdog itself survives a forced reboot. Record the exact firmware build you tested, which should match the token printed below.

trace token, fafog-kageg: htk4_98e6

// Reconnect bug history: the Pylon gateway client used to drop its
// websocket after idle timeouts and reconnect with a stale session
// token, causing silent message loss on the Harborline feed. Fixed in
// v2.4 by forcing a full handshake on every reconnect — do NOT revert
// to the cached-session path, it will reintroduce the bug. The client
// below must authenticate fresh each time. Use the credential issued
// for the Harborline relay, shown on the next line.

app token of kagap-fafop = zpat7_kxsDrhD

Ticket: Config drift on Nightloom backfill scheduler.

Prod and staging diverged again. Staging got the new retry window during the Harkwell migration; prod never did. Result: nightly backfills on prod start an hour early and collide with the Vexa export job. Third occurrence this quarter. Proposal: move scheduler config into the managed pipeline, remove manual edits. Needs a decision at sync. For reference, the values currently live on prod are below.

settings of tagef-bawif:
DRUIX_HOST=druix.zemvarlabs.internal
DRUIX_PORT=8000

Subject: Key rotation for PixelShrink CLI

Hey folks! Welcome to the team. Quick heads-up: we rotated the credentials for PixelShrink, our batch image resizing CLI, as part of quarterly hygiene. The old key stops working Friday, so update your local config before then. Run `pixelshrink auth set` and paste in the new value. Here's the fresh key for the resize service:

service key, fawip-bajef: kto11_Qt5wZK9vdNC